Former ONE Strawweight MMA World Champion Jarred “The Monkey God” Brooks is focused on the future. He’s set to throw down against Cuba’s Gustavo Balart at ONE Fight Night 24: Brooks vs. Balart. This fight for the ONE Interim Strawweight MMA World Championship airs on US primetime on August 2nd. This is a chance for Brooks to reclaim a piece of gold. 

In a recent interview with a reputable media outlet, Brooks vowed to deliver a thrilling fight that will amaze not only the fans but also ONE Championship’s Chairman and CEO, Chatri Sityodtong.

Jarred Brooks came in hot since arriving in the world’s largest martial arts organization in 2021. He collected three straight victories on his way to claiming the ONE Strawweight MMA World title against Joshua Pacio at the end of 2022. Unfortunately, he failed to keep the belt in his first defense – a rematch against Pacio earlier this year in Qatar. The quick match ended in a disqualification for Brooks, forcing him to surrender his belt to the Filipino fighter.

Now, in an interview with Sportskeeda MMA, Brooks promised himself to deliver a spectacular finish. He said, “I want to go out there and have a spectacular finish. Wow Chatri [Sityodtong], wow the judges, wow everyone and the fans over in Thailand.”

Jarred Brooks commits to personal evolution

Now fans will see a new version of ‘The Monkey God’ returning next month, following an unfortunate event earlier this year, an unintentional wrong move that cost him his title. With Joshua Pacio currently unavailable because of an injury during training, Jarred Brooks will fight for the interim title belt against Gustavo Balart.

In his recent interview with Sportskeeda MMA, Brooks laid out his plans, stating, “This is my chance to right my mistakes from the past fight. I’ve said this in a couple of interviews and yeah, this is gonna be a new Monkey God. Everything is much better and so on. So yeah, the evolution is gonna be there for sure.”
